How does a pillar airbag deploy?
Imagine A-pillars so thin they improve the driver's forward visibility by 25 percent and reduce (local) weight by 10 percent. During an accident, a pyrotechnic charge built into the base of each pillar fires to pressurize these specially folded, airtight steel tubes to 435 psi.
What is the A pillar of a car?
November 7, 2021. In the case of cars, “pillars” refer to roof pillars, and they're lettered front to back. A-Pillars straddle the windshield, B-Pillars are in the middle of the passenger compartment (just behind the front doors) and C-Pillars are those at the rear of the passenger compartment.

Introduction
We’ll be showing you how to remove the A Pillar trim, and associated trim around the triangular glass alongside the dashboard on your MK7 Golf. This tutorial will be helpful if you’re installing a dashcam / radar detector, upgrading your speakers, or tinting this small section of glass.
Step 5
Continue to seperate the A Pillar Trim from the vehicle. You will then be able to unplug the tweeter by squeezing the connector.
Step 6
The trim is now ready to be released from the dashboard. This step is quite difficult, and takes some twisting and firm pulling to release the trim.
Step 7
The trim surrounding the triangular glass can now be released. Use a trim removal tool to release the clip, and push upwards from the bottom. It will twist out of the dashboard.
